Output 10043ac760e681750253afb30d179caf37bb28ac500160f681c8168c9e7ff30a:0

value
200507009
script pubkey
OP_0 OP_PUSHBYTES_20 61bd90762b36c602ff9b13598f820cd1396f702f
address
bc1qvx7eqa3txmrq9lumzdvclqsv6yuk7up02t2c94
transaction
10043ac760e681750253afb30d179caf37bb28ac500160f681c8168c9e7ff30a
confirmations
217603
spent
true